Joint Parliamentary Assembly sends strong message to EU on development dimension of economic partnership agreements but fails to agree on situation in Eastern Africa

Bridgetown, 24/11/2006 (Agence Europe) - The work of the 70 MEPs and their counterparts from the ACP (Africa, Caribbean and Pacific) states linked to the EU under the Cotonou Agreement ended in Barbados on Thursday with a Joint Parliamentary Assembly (JPA) particularly rich in political debate, comical incidents and contrasted results.
